事务级建模:EDA/PLD验证的关键驱动力

0 下载量 132 浏览量 更新于2024-08-31 收藏 308KB PDF 举报
"EDA/PLD中的新兴标准如TLM(事务级建模)2.0和SCE-MI在验证领域中起到了推动作用,促进了基于事务的验证方法学的广泛应用。事务级建模允许更快速的模拟和更有效的调试,同时也支持早期软件开发、系统定义和可执行规范的描述。通过硬件加速和仿真,验证流程得以加速,提高了设计效率。" 在电子设计自动化(EDA)和可编程逻辑器件(PLD)领域,标准化是技术普及的关键。以Verilog为例,其标准化推动了寄存器传输级(RTL)综合的广泛应用。而在验证阶段,事务级建模(TLM)成为一种重要的方法学,特别是在OSCI的TLM 2.0和Accellera的SCE-MI等标准的推动下,事务验证逐渐成为主流。 事务级建模的核心价值在于它能够在系统设计建模中实现多方面的目标。首先,它支持早期软件开发,允许软件开发者在硬件完全实现之前就开始编写和测试代码。其次,它可以用于早期系统定义,帮助设计师在架构层面探索不同的设计方案。最后,事务模型能够作为可执行规范,使设计师在做架构权衡时有清晰的参考。 事务的优势在于其速度和调试便利性。使用TLM,模拟速度显著提高,因为通信过程被抽象到了较高层次,减少了不必要的细节处理。此外,由于事务模型关注功能而较少涉及实现细节,调试变得更加高效。模型的独立性使得它们可以在不同应用场景或工艺节点间复用,增加了设计的灵活性和可维护性。 采用TLM的验证流程常常结合硬件加速和仿真技术,这有助于进一步缩短验证周期,加快产品上市时间。硬件加速器可以模拟关键模块,以提高整体仿真性能,而仿真工具则处理其他部分,确保整个系统级别的验证。 EDA/PLD中的新兴标准如TLM和SCE-MI在提升基于事务的验证效率方面发挥了重要作用,它们简化了复杂系统的验证过程,促进了设计质量和速度的提升,同时也为系统设计提供了更为灵活和高效的建模手段。随着标准的不断发展和完善,我们可以期待更多创新方法的出现,以应对不断增长的设计复杂性和挑战。